Other applications relate to improving communication among professionals and institutions. In this regard, there is growing interest in studying the discursive strategies used by public and legal entitiesto communicate with different audiences, to inform citizens of their rights and obligations, or to explain relevant procedures. Communication in crisis situations and conflict resolution is also becoming increasingly important. Likewise, we work to explore in depth the communication techniques used in the health and care sectors and in any aspect of internship related to language use.

We are open to partnership interdisciplinary projects in which linguistic analysis techniques play a decisive role. For example, in recent years we have collaborated on research projects research the communication of climate risks, the diagnosis of psychological traits through the analysis of patient essays, the application of linguistic criteria to the legal analysis of defamation and speech , NGO communication during migration crises, and the analysis of the effects of AI on thepublishing house.
